Application for approval of the Infrastructure Victoria Plant Depot Agreement 2024 - 2028
An application has been made for approval of an enterprise agreement known as the Infrastructure Victoria Plant Depot Agreement 2024 - 2028 (the Agreement). The application was made pursuant to s.185 of the Fair Work Act 2009 (the Act). It has been made by John Holland Pty Ltd T/A John Holland Pty Ltd. The Agreement is a single enterprise agreement.
The notification time for the Agreement under s.173(2) was 20 September 2024 and the Agreement was made on 11 November 2024. Accordingly, both the genuine agreement and the better off overall test requirements are those applying on and from 6 June 2023.[1]
The Employer has provided written undertakings. A copy of the undertakings is attached in Annexure A. I am satisfied that the undertakings will not cause financial detriment to any employee covered by the Agreement and that the undertakings will not result in substantial changes to the Agreement. The undertakings are taken to be a term of the agreement.
Subject to the undertakings referred to above, I am satisfied that each of the requirements of ss.186, 187, 188, 193 and 193A as are relevant to this application for approval have been met.
Pursuant to s.205A of the Act, the workplace delegates’ rights term at Clause 40A of the Manufacturing and Associated Industries and Occupations Award 2020 is taken to be a term of the Agreement.
The Agreement is approved and, in accordance with s.54 of the Act, will operate from 5 February 2025. The nominal expiry date of the Agreement is 5 February 2029.

[1] The Fair Work Legislation Amendment (Secure Jobs, Better Pay) Act 2022 (Cth) made a number of changes to enterprise agreement approval processes in Part 2-4 of the Fair Work Act. Those changes broadly commenced operation on 6 June 2023, subject to various transitional arrangements which are not applicable to the present application.
